inquiry
简单释义:
n. 调查;询问;追究
网络 询盘;查询;询价
变形:
复数:inquiries
完整释义:
n.
1.调查,研究,查询,打听;问道,询问情况
2.探访;检查;究竟
3.调查,审查
4.调查工作
5.询问,质问;追究
6.询价书
7.玄想,好奇心
v.
1.问诊
